Ambassador Mirošič on a visit in Colorado state
Ambassador Iztok Mirošič visited Colorado state between January 22 - 24, 2025, where he officially inaugurated consulate of the Republic of Slovenia. He met with Colorado Governor Jared Polis at the State Capitol in Denver and members of the Colorado National Guard. He also visited the headquarters of the U.S. Space Command in Colorado Springs, town of Pueblo and toured the Pueblo Community College.

The 34th Day of Slovenian Independence and Unity at the Slovenian Embassy in Washington
On December 10, 2024, the Ambassador hosted a reception for the Slovenian community in Washington on the occasion of the 34th Day of Slovenian Independence and Unity. Photographer Alenka Slavinec organized the opening of a photography exhibition about Lipizzaner horses, whose story is inseparably connected to Operation Cowboy, which enabled some of the horses to return to Lipica.

Annual meeting of Honorary Consuls from the United States, United States of Mexico and the Republic of Panama
On October 25, 2024, the Embassy of Slovenia in Washington organized the annual meeting of Honorary Consuls from the United States, the United Mexican States, and the Republic of Panama. This year’s keynote speakers were the Slovenian Minister of Finance, Klemen Boštjančič, and the Governor of the Bank of Slovenia, Boštjan Vasle.
